KABUL (Pajhwok): President Hamid Karzai on Friday condemned a bomb blast that ripped through a busy marketplace in the capital of northern Balkh province, leaving three shoppers dead and 10 others wounded a day earlier.
The blast near the Hazrat Ali Mausoleum took place at a time when people were preparing for the breaking of fast (iftari) in Mazar-i-Sharif.
Karzai condemned the death of innocent civilians in the blast as a blind act of terrorism in a statement released from his office.
The president said killing innocent people in this holy month of Ramadan was the greatest sin on the part of those hell-bent on shedding the blood of Afghans.
Karzai extended his deep condolences to the families who lost their beloved ones in the terrorist attack and prayed for early recovery of those injured.
